पंद्रह साल से रोहतक शहर के वास्तविक प्रदूषण डाटा पर चादर ताने खड़ा एचपीसीबी

The Haryana Pollution Control Board (HPCB) set up a monitoring station in Rohtak around 2008–09 to collect air pollution data, but it has remained non-functional for nearly 15 years. Covered with metal sheets and lying idle, the station has failed to provide accurate pollution readings for the city. The report criticises HPCB for neglecting maintenance and failing to install or operate modern monitoring systems.

Despite data gaps, Gurgaon's October AQI this year worse than last 2

This October seemed to promise clean air, with the average air quality index (AQI) remaining below 200 (moderate) in the city. But with most monitoring stations going dark throughout the month, a true picture of AQI is guesswork. Gurgaon ended Oct with an AQI of 195 on Friday. At first glance, this might appear to be an improvement, but Gurgaon saw a decline in air quality going by the data.

Delhi’s AQI sees unexpected sharp drop, lowest reading in three years for October

Delhi's air quality dramatically improved, dropping from a three-year October high to 'moderate' levels. This significant shift, without rain, has experts puzzled. The government credits extensive enforcement teams, anti-smog guns, and road sweeping. While meteorological factors like lower humidity and wind shifts played a role, the full reasons for this sudden improvement remain under investigation.
